General Information

Title: Audi Domine hymnum
Composer: Claudio Merulo
Lyricist: 1 Kings ch.8, v. 28,29 (adapted)create page

Number of voices: 6vv   Voicings: SAAATB and ATTTBB
Genre: SacredMotet

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ella

First published: 1598 in Sacrae symphoniae, no. 25

Description: This setting of a section of Solomon's song of dedication for the temple in Jerusalem is appropriate for use at the dedication of a church, or for general use.
